Hey guys, my supra got hit today by someone while I was parked, pretty bummed about it.

It looks pretty bad but looking up close it seems as if it just needs a new bumper and a new headlight.

Any idea how long these take to get ordered from toyota?

Also, How would this affect the resale value?
Nothing got damaged except the bumper and the headlights, so no internal wiring or frame damage at all.


Im just curious because I loved driving this car and seeing if anyone else has had any similar experiences.

RIP sorry to hear bro. This is Rei from Discord. I'd call your local toyota dealership for an ETA on the bumper and headlight. But I made a quote to give you a rough idea on numbers. I don't see the car on different angles so I'm only guessing with internals and some brackets/sensor pieces.

Parts to be replaced: F bumper, side parking sensor unit, side parking sensor bracket, side parking sensor ring, LeftF bumper bracket, LeftF bumper retainer, F bumper absorber, LeftF headlight.

Roughly $3900~ parts, labor, paint. All tax rates and such are taken from PA's pov. No blend paint time on the surrounding areas was added since we aren't doing work on the a panel like fenders.

All of which are coming as OEM. I left out the left front reflector, and the left front side spoiler (your left front lip) since these are aftermarket. This should give you a rough idea on what you're looking at if you were to get it done at a collision center.

Same thing… some hillbilly in a 10 year old beater Toundra (a Toyota, no less…?) backed in to my baby. $CDN 4,000, the shop did an amazing job of fixing/painting. Took 5 days once they started, waited 2 weeks to get it in the (very busy) dealer’s shop.
